Freeservers.com / 4t.com is the only one I still have anything to do with. I have a fishing guide buddy I trade favors with, and I hosted his guide service site there. At one time they took invasive advertising that tried to load things like Gator, but I have not seen that type of thing in a long time. You can use their built in page builder, or you can build pages off line and upload them. Doesn't support scripting of any kind. Don't even think it supports SSI, but it does seem to work ok for basic static pages... and yes its advertising supported. Don't recall what their storage limit is, but its enough to run a basic site. For all of my websites, I have an unlimited storage high bandwidth unlimited domains account with IMHOSTED.com. I fought with them off and on, but unlike other hosts who got worse, they seem to have gotten better and more stable over time. I think I've been with them longer than any other hosting service I've used over the years except 4t.com for free sites. |
